Former Fed chairs condemn criminal investigation into Jerome Powell

✨ Key Highlights
Three former chairs of the US Federal Reserve, including Janet Yellen, Ben Bernanke, and Alan Greenspan, have strongly condemned a criminal investigation into current Chair Jerome Powell, labeling it an attempt to undermine the central bank's independence. This condemnation comes after Powell revealed the US Department of Justice (DoJ) is investigating his testimony regarding renovations to Federal Reserve buildings.
- Three former Fed chairs and 10 other former officials issued a statement supporting Jerome Powell.
- The DoJ investigation is seen as "unprecedented" and potentially linked to President Donald Trump's dissatisfaction with the Fed's interest rate policies.
- Yellen called the probe "extremely chilling" and expressed concern it reflects a desire to remove Powell, possibly leading to a "banana republic" scenario.
- President Trump has publicly urged the Fed to cut interest rates and spent months attacking Powell on social media, even considering firing him.
- The investigation could disrupt the confirmation process for Powell's replacement, whose term ends in May.
